"We are pleased to offer for sale this charming two double bedroomed town house situated in the highly sought after village of Hungarton. The property itself is deceptively spacious and enjoys views to the front and rear. The property itself benefits from LPG gas fired central heating, UPVC Double Glazing. The accommodation is entered via a double glazed door into entrance hall which has stairs rising to first floor, tiled flooring, built in under stairs storage cupboard and doorways giving access to the following: The lounge has a UPVC bay window over looking the front elevation having solid wood park a flooring, exposed brick chimney breast, housing a cast iron multi fuel burner with tiled hearth and TV point. The kitchen/diner is fitted with a range of modern base units with roll edge work surfaces over, tiled splash backs, wall mounted combination boiler, UPVC double glazed window over looking the rear, ceramic tiled flooring, space for dining table and opening giving access to the utility area which has a range of modern base units, with roll edge work surfaces over, composite sink and drainer unit with mixer tap, tiled splash backs, space for fridge freezer, plumbing for washing machine, continuation of the tiled flooring and UPVC double glazed door giving access to the rear garden. To the first floor there are two double bedrooms. Bedroom one having a range of built in wardrobes and storage cupboard and window over looking the front elevation. Bedroom two also has a built in wardrobe and UPVC double glazed window over looking the rear garden and nearby countryside. The bathroom has been fitted with a white modern suite comprising of panelled bath with shower over with glass side screen, pedestal wash hand basin, vinyl flooring, tiled walls throughout, vinyl flooring and UPVC obscure window the rear. There is a separate WC which has tile effect vinyl flooring, low level WC and obscure window to the rear. Also to the first floor there is a study area which is ideal for a desk, chair and computer station and has a window over looking the front elevation. Outside there is a block paved frontage and a particular feature of the property is a beautifully maintained rear garden which offers a fantastic private entertaining space with paved patio area surrounded by dwarf brick walls and steps rising to the lawned area. The lawned area has greenhouse, raised decked area and a mature cherry tree. There are two outside brick sheds, which have plumbing for washing machine and power points in both. There is a side gate giving access to the shared side entry.
